PEOPLING THE PACIFIC
PROFESSOR MACMILLAN BROWN
THEORY,
By Telegraph—Press Association —Copyright. BRISBANE, August 2.
Professor Macmillan Brown, of Now Zealand, has returned heiax-from a visit to tho Solomon Islands. As tho result of his investigations Professor Brown is of opinion that tho Solomons form tho key to the question of tho peopling of tho Pacific. The presence of a typo of European faces among the natives show that a lighthaired European race has gone into the PaciEa,
